Challenges of Extreme Temperatures



Extreme temperatures can posture considerable obstacles for roof covering installation. If you're working in extreme warm, materials like asphalt tiles can end up being extremely flexible, making them tough to position precisely. You may discover that the glue used for roofing materials does not bond correctly, leading to prospective concerns down the line.

On the other hand, when temperatures drop, materials can end up being brittle. This brittleness can cause shingles to break or damage throughout installation, compromising the honesty of your roof covering.

Furthermore, extreme cold can slow down the healing process of adhesives and sealants, making it harder for them to establish properly. You may require to wait longer before applying extra layers or completing the project.
